Description

This submission contains the demo files used in the Global Optimization with MATLAB webinar: http://www.mathworks.com/wbnr43346

MultStart Demos

    * Peaks Minimization
    * Nonlinear Curve Fitting

GlobalSearch Demos

    * Peaks Minimization
    * Volumentric Efficiency Maximization

Simulated Annealing Demos

    * Peaks Minimization
    * Eight Queens Problem
    * Galactic Traveling Salesman

Pattern Search Demos

    * Peaks Minimization
    * Mount Washington Demo

Genetic Algorithm Demos

    * Peaks Minmiziation
    * Rastrigins Function Minimization
    * Partical Swarm Example
    * Multiobjective Genetic Algorithm

Comparison of Solvers on Rastrigins Function

    * Comparison of Multiple Solvers on Rastrings

Required Products Global Optimization Toolbox
Optimization Toolbox
Parallel Computing Toolbox
MATLAB release MATLAB 7.10 (2010a)
Other requirements Global Optimization Toolbox (fromerly Genetic Algorithm and Direct Search Toolbox)
